Abstract

The invention relates to an anti-icing cable applicable to ice rain atrocious weather and matched auxiliary facilities with anti-icing property. An anti-icing field metal tower body is characterized in that the surface of an easy-icing part of the tower body is provided with an anti-icing element; and the anti-icing element is arranged on rod and column surfaces consisting of the tower body by means of clamping, covering, coating or adhering. A method for arranging the anti-icing sleeve or the anti-icing element on the easy-icing part of the tower body effectively prevents the surface of the easy-icing part from icing, greatly reduces the heat exchange with the outside, and effectively prevents the icing phenomenon caused by heat absorption after rainwater is directly contacted with the tower body.

Technical field
The present invention relates to a kind of anti-condensation ice electric wire or cable that is applicable under the ice rain harsh weather, and with electric wire or the matching used supporting facility of cable with anti-condensation ice characteristic.
Background technology
Because Chinese area is vast, stride a plurality of warm areas, so each province temperature difference is bigger, the sleet disaster happens occasionally.From southern china freezing rain and snow disaster situation in 2008, air themperature is lower than zero degree near ground, altitude air is wet warm relatively and down when sleet or sleet, when raindrop or sleet are run into ice-cold power line, iron tower tower body or insulating bottle, because these objects are good conductors of heat, can rapidly the conduction of the heat in the rainwater be come, and in the cold air around being discharged into, in other words rapidly with the cold guiding raindrop in the cold-peace ambient cold air of object itself, change into ice so can instantaneous most of raindrop be condensed, thereby attached to these body surfaces.Raindrop afterwards fall within on ice successively, continue to coagulate ice, cause ice sheet constantly to thicken, the continuous overstriking of icicle on the power line, the weight of ice sheet icicle constantly increases, when these imposts cause its utmost carrying ability that power transmission tower reaches prior to power line, tower body will at first collapse, and cause power failure; When power line took the lead in reaching its utmost carrying ability, power line will rupture, and then caused power transmission tower unbalance loading overload, thereby collapsed.Because there was dampness in the air in south, sunlight can not see through cloud layer, thawing during ice sheet for a long time, and airborne moisture can slowly condense on the ice sheet that is lower than zero degree, makes that to ice phenomenon with fixed attention more serious.For transmission of wireless signals tower and signal transmission device thereof, exist to coagulate ice problem too, in case take place to coagulate ice, gently then influence the signal transmission, heavy then cause tower body to collapse.Also have power line, transmission of electricity bar and the tensioned thread of electric railway, also all has ice problem with fixed attention, in case ice appears coagulating, gently then influence power supply, and heavy then cause electric wire to rupture.
What these natural calamities jeopardized all is national lifeline engineering, not only can cause enormous economic loss, brings great inconvenience for people's life, when serious even the life security that jeopardizes people.
Summary of the invention
For addressing the above problem, the invention provides a kind of anti-condensation ice cable that can prevent that rainwater or moisture from freezing on its surface.
Be to provide a kind of anti-condensation ice insulating bottle another order of the present invention.
The present invention is to provide a kind of anti-condensation ice metal tower body with also having an order.
Anti-condensation ice cable of the present invention is achieved in that a kind of anti-condensation ice cable, it is characterized in that cable cover connects anti-condensation set, and gapped between anti-condensation set inner surface and the cable surface, anti-condensation set can be rotated relative to cable.
Anti-condensation set adopts the profile of low air resistance coefficient, and its shape of cross section is that water droplet shape, ellipse, fusiformis, two sharp water droplet shape, circle, C shape or the whirlpool of hollow is leaf.Wherein fusiformis, two sharp water droplet shape have cutwater and split, and can be reduced to the rain vertical plane of meeting of anti-condensation set almost nil, make the rapid landing of raindrop; Anti-condensation set is arranged to the leaf shape in whirlpool can makes anti-condensation set under the wind-force effect, do not stop to wind the line cable rotation, the sleet that drops on the cable is got rid of.Anti-condensation set adopts closing structure, opening structure, single opening structure or helical structure and cable cover is connected together.
Described anti-condensation set is made of coefficient of thermal conductivity low non-metal inorganic material or macromolecular material.When anti-condensation set was made of expanded material, preferred expanded material adopted by middle mind-set both sides fine and close gradually, or the fine and close gradually form of structure of layering, can improve effect of heat insulation, guarantees the intensity of material surfaces externally and internally when saving material.Described anti-condensation set can directly be made by water-proof material, can incorporate water-proof material in the anti-condensation set material, also can be provided with on the anti-condensation set surface and refuse moisture film.
In order anti-condensation set to be kept help most the state of sleet landing, by the anti-condensation set wall thickness change or counterweight is set or adopts the material of different specific weight to make the deviation of gravity center cable center of anti-condensation set.
Because cable, can and contact object generation interchange of heat with after external object contact, sometimes even can have influence on its transmission electric current or signal,, can projection be set at interval at the inner surface that anti-condensation set contacts with cable in order to reduce the gross area that anti-condensation set contacts with cable.Projection should discontinuous as far as possible setting, for example is arranged to graininess and just can effectively reduces real contact area with cable, and is from technological angle with reduce the angle of swing resistance, the most convenient with annular protrusion or spiral-shaped projection.
In addition; wave and the anti-condensation set pendulum that quivers in order to prevent under external force effects such as high wind cable; in the gap between anti-condensation set inner surface and cable external surface the fluid damping material is set; when anti-condensation set or cable vibration; anti-condensation set is with respect to cable generation relative motion; the distortion of force fluid damping material, the adhesion damping force of damping material can consume the nuisance vibration energy, effectively protects cable to avoid damaging.When the fluid damping material is set, should be at the anti-condensation set two ends with the damping material flexible sealing, or anti-condensation set is divided into multistage, the segmentation flexible sealing; If select the bigger anti-condensation set material of rigidity, can improve the effect of damping energy dissipation.
Anti-condensation ice cable of the present invention, by in cable outer setting anti-condensation set, anti-condensation set and shape of cross section thereof by the activity setting, can make anti-condensation set adjust the best automatically and meet the rain angle of facining the wind, improve the raindrop collision angle, reduce sleet and be detained the blind area or it is disappeared, and the wind resistance when strong wind weather is also less, alleviates waving of cable; The use of water-proof material can reduce the microcosmic contact area, sleet fall to be gone up after landing rapidly, reduce the holdup time, thereby can effectively prevent to coagulate and ice on the cable surface; Anti-condensation set adopts low Heat Conduction Material, can significantly reduce raindrop and line and pull latent heat rate of release and the cold conduction of velocity that contacts when icing with fixed attention, significantly reduces speed of icing with fixed attention.In addition, the use of the configuration design of anti-condensation set, damping material also makes the cable surface be not easy to accumulate the sleet dust at ordinary times among the present invention, and electric wire is waved and vibration is effectively suppressed when strong wind weather.
In sum, the anti-condensation ice cable of the present invention can prevent effectively that the cable surface from icing the generation of phenomenon with fixed attention, guarantee freezing safety and normal use of waiting various empty stringing cables under the hazard weather of sleet, be specially adapted to the power line and the tensioned thread of various electric wires that outdoor empty frame is provided with, holding wire, optical cable, electric railway, dependable performance under the various at all seasons weather conditions, anti-condensation ice is effective, anti-harsh weather ability is strong, can effectively guarantee the normal use that people produce, live, reduce the risk of accidental loss, have high application value.
Open-air transmission of electricity of the present invention is achieved in that on the surface of easily icing with fixed attention of insulating bottle with insulating bottle anti-condensation set is set.Anti-condensation set is shaped as taper shape, annular, mushroom-shaped, or the anti-condensation set soffit is similar with the corresponding surface configuration of bottle, and the external diameter of anti-condensation set is equal to or greater than the external diameter of insulating bottle.The center of anti-condensation set is provided with through hole, or is provided with radial opening, can overlap the central protuberance place that rides over insulating bottle.Anti-condensation set is made of coefficient of thermal conductivity low non-metal inorganic material or macromolecular material, or melts in the material water-proof material is arranged, or is provided with at its external surface and refuses moisture film.
By icing the surface easily coagulating of insulating bottle, particularly on the full skirt anti-condensation set is set, anti-condensation set is made of coefficient of thermal conductivity low non-metal inorganic material or macromolecular material, reduced heat-transfer rate, thereby reduced speed of icing with fixed attention, can prevent that rainwater from fall going up the moment that causes because of heat behind the insulating bottle and coagulating and ice, utilize simultaneously and in the anti-condensation set material, add water-proof material or increase technical measures such as refusing moisture film on the anti-condensation set surface, improved the water repellency of anti-condensation set, microcosmic area and time of contact that anti-condensation set contacts with raindrop have been reduced, the rapid slippage of meeting after making rainwater fall to going up is avoided accumulating, thereby prevents that effectively insulating bottle from ice taking place to coagulate.Be specially adapted to the insulating bottle that open-air power transmission and transformation are used, help improving the security performance of power transmission and transformation system, reduce maintenance cost, ensure people's production, living needs better.
The open-air metal tower body of the anti-condensation ice of the present invention is achieved in that on the surface, position of easily icing with fixed attention of tower body anti-condensation element is set.Anti-condensation element is split at the vertical cutwater that has, or/and have low air resistance coefficient in the horizontal direction, its cross section is water droplet shape, ellipse, fusiformis, two sharp water droplet shape or circle.Anti-condensation element is shell-like, tabular or sheet, and is arranged on bar, the post surface of forming tower body with snapping, socket, coating or bonding way.Anti-condensation element is made of coefficient of thermal conductivity low non-metal inorganic material or macromolecular material, or melts in the material water-proof material is arranged, or is provided with at its external surface and refuses moisture film.
By the surface, position of easily icing with fixed attention anti-condensation element is set at tower body, anti-condensation element is made of coefficient of thermal conductivity low non-metal inorganic material or macromolecular material, reduce tower body and easily coagulated the surperficial heat-transfer rate of ice, thereby reduced speed of icing with fixed attention, can prevent that rainwater from falling to going up the back and coagulating ice because of the moment that heat causes; And utilize and in anti-condensation element material, add water-proof material or set up technical measures such as refusing moisture film at anti-condensation element surface, improved the water repellency of tower body simultaneously, can reduce the microcosmic contact area of raindrop and anti-condensation element, the rapid slippage of meeting after making sleet fall to going up, reduce time of contact, and avoid accumulating, thereby effectively prevent to ice with fixed attention the generation of phenomenon; By the shape of anti-condensation element, that can reduce anti-condensation element meets the rain surface, improves the raindrop collision angle, reduces sleet and is detained the blind area or makes its disappearance.

The specific embodiment
Embodiment one
The anti-condensation ice cable of the present invention comprises the anti-condensation set 2 that cable 1 and surface thereof are provided with as shown in Figure 1, leaves the gap between anti-condensation set 2 inner surfaces and cable 1 external surface, can relatively rotate between the two.Wherein, cable 1 is the holding wire of outdoor empty frame, and the polyurethane material that anti-condensation set 2 is low by coefficient of thermal conductivity, density is little is made, and its cross section is the closed circle structure of hollow.In order to prevent interchange of heat, reduce the real contact area between anti-condensation set and the cable, the inner surface that contacts with cable in anti-condensation set is provided with some graininess projectioies 3 at interval.
Owing to be provided with anti-condensation set 2, significantly reduced cable and extraneous exchange heat, when having avoided rainwater directly to drop on the cable,, effectively avoided the cable surface to ice the generation of phenomenon with fixed attention because of rainwater moment that cable conducts rapidly that heat causes is coagulated ice.Can effectively ensure the operate as normal of cable under the freezing rain and snow disaster weather, prevent that economic loss and the casualties avoiding so bring have good economic benefit and social benefit because of coagulating cable and the related facility damage thereof that ice causes.
Embodiment two
The anti-condensation ice cable of the present invention is the power line of open-air empty frame with the different cables 1 that are of embodiment one as shown in Figure 2, is made of multiply metal core.Anti-condensation set 2 is made by the low expanded material of coefficient of thermal conductivity, and adopts by the fine and close gradually internal construction in middle mind-set both sides, to improve its effect of heat insulation, keeps smooth surface; In order to improve the outlet capacity of refusing of product, anti-condensation set 2 surfaces also are provided with refuses moisture film 4.Since anti-condensation set be shaped as smooth mellow and full pipe, the blind area of having eliminated the storage sleet of multiply cable; The application of heat-barrier material and water-proof material has reduced raindrop and has run into coagulating speed of icing and discharging latent heat speed of anti-condensation set, has reduced the microcosmic contact area and the holdup time of raindrop and anti-condensation set, thus greatly reduce coagulate ice accumulate may and accumulative speed.
Under external force effects such as high wind; cable and anti-condensation set might wave or tremble; in the gap between anti-condensation set inner surface and cable external surface fluid damping material 5 is set for this reason; the fluid damping material is a silicone oil; utilize fluid damping material 5 to consume energy, can effectively protect cable to avoid damaging.
Principle based on present embodiment; when the cable surface only is provided with the anti-condensation set of no heat insulating function and waterproofing function; in the gap between anti-condensation set inner surface and cable external surface the fluid damping material is set, also can realizes alleviating the cable vibration, the effect that the protection cable is without prejudice.In addition, expanded material can improve the surface strength of anti-condensation set by the fine and close gradually form of structure of middle mind-set both sides layering, saves material.
Embodiment three
The anti-condensation ice cable of the present invention as shown in Figure 3 comprises the anti-condensation set of cable and outer setting thereof.Described cable 1 is the power line of open-air empty frame, is made of multiply metal core.Described anti-condensation set is made of jointly the moisture film 4 of refusing that PVC base material 10 and surface thereof are provided with, and refusing moisture film is Teflon.In order to help the sleet landing, anti-condensation set is arranged to the water droplet shape shape that cross section is a hollow.In order to guarantee that when the hot weather cable can efficiently radiates heat, be provided with a plurality of through holes 6 in the bottom of anti-condensation set.For preventing that the side that anti-condensation set has a through hole from going to unfavorable phenomenon such as intake in the anti-condensation set that the top of cable causes and taking place, water droplet shape tip in anti-condensation set is provided with counterweight 7, counterweight 7 is a wire, like this because tip weight is bigger, a side that can guarantee through hole under the effect of deadweight be in all the time cable below.
Refuse moisture film and help the water droplet shape structure that sleet comes off because the anti-condensation set that cable surface is provided with has adopted, so sleet is difficult for accumulating, can effectively prevent to ice with fixed attention the generation of phenomenon.When strong wind or blast weather, because anti-condensation set can be rotated (swing) relative to cable, anti-condensation set can be adjusted to the best angle of facining the wind automatically, and wind resistance is dropped to minimum, because wind does not produce eddy current before and after during by raindrop shape anti-condensation set, so cable is difficult for waving; Even when anti-condensation set did not have heat insulation and waterproofing function, cable also was difficult for waving.
Embodiment four
The anti-condensation ice cable of the present invention as shown in Figure 4, be with the difference of embodiment three, anti-condensation set 11 directly utilizes water-proof material to make, and adopt opening structure, utilize bayonet socket 8 that anti-condensation set amalgamation and cable 1 are connected together during assembling, this assembly structure can conveniently install anti-condensation set additional on existing cable.In order to make anti-condensation ice cable keep helping most the state of sleet landing as far as possible, the wall thickness of anti-condensation set 11 is arranged to different-thickness, make the deviation of gravity center cable center of anti-condensation set 11 cross sections, near its tip, under the deadweight effect, the anti-condensation ice cable of the present invention keeps the most advanced and sophisticated attitude that helps the sleet landing most down naturally, and can adjust the angle of facining the wind automatically along with the increase of wind-force.
Control the center of gravity of product in addition by the material that different specific weight is set on anti-condensation set, also can realize adjusting automatically the effect of anti-condensation ice cable attitude.
Embodiment five
The anti-condensation ice cable of the present invention comprises the anti-condensation set 2 that cable 1 and surface thereof are provided with as shown in Figure 5, leaves the gap between anti-condensation set 2 inner surfaces and cable 1 external surface, can relatively rotate between the two.Wherein, cable 1 is made for the outdoor power line of electric railway, the bipeltate that anti-condensation set 2 is low by coefficient of thermal conductivity, density is little, and its cross section is the ellipsoidal structure of hollow, and center of gravity on the lower side; For the ease of with the cable socket, an opening 9 is set on anti-condensation set, promptly constitute described single opening structure.The anti-condensation set surface has also sprayed one deck and has refused moisture film 4.
Because anti-condensation set adopts oval-shaped profile, and sets up the water-proof material film on the surface, very help the sleet landing, and can prevent between sleet and the cable interchange of heat to take place, therefore can effectively prevent to ice with fixed attention the generation of phenomenon.
When using this routine described technical scheme, the material of the anti-condensation set of selecting for use has certain elasticity, like this after opening 9 suit cables, because the flexible effect of anti-condensation set material self, the opening two ends can fit together automatically, can avoid entering of water or dust like this.
Because in the present embodiment, anti-condensation set adopts single opening structure, can be sleeved on the cable outside later stage, therefore can be used for the anti-condensation ice transformation of existing cable.When the opening of single opening structure is big, be C shape both, go for the cable of some specific occasion.
Embodiment six
The anti-condensation ice cable of the present invention comprises cable 1 and anti-condensation set 2 as shown in Figure 6.Wherein cable is the metal tensioned thread of the outdoor power line of electric railway, and anti-condensation set 2 is made by the low non-metal inorganic material of coefficient of thermal conductivity, is added with the nanometer water-proof material in the non-metal inorganic material, thereby has thermal insulation and water repellency concurrently.Anti-condensation set adopts two sharp water droplet shape structures, and most advanced and sophisticated formation cutwater is split, and deposits with rain and snow; Utilize the different wall thickness of anti-condensation set to form counterweight naturally, adjust center of gravity, be beneficial to the attitude and the attitude of facining the wind that sleet comes off so that anti-condensation set maintains all the time automatically.
Based on principle of the present invention, anti-condensation set can also adopt the profile of fusiformis, also can play good effect.The existing water effect of dividing preferably of this type of anti-condensation set shape has less air resistance coefficient again.
Embodiment seven
The anti-condensation ice cable of the present invention as shown in Figure 7 comprises cable 1 and anti-condensation set 2, and wherein cable 1 is outdoor power line, and anti-condensation set 2 and macromolecular material light specific gravity low by coefficient of thermal conductivity constitutes.Also be provided with on the anti-condensation set 2 and be provided with hollowly in the whirlpool leaf of whirlpool leaf 12, one sides, can adjust center of gravity.When wind-force reaches certain intensity, can drive the whirlpool leaf and then drive anti-condensation set rotation continuously on cable, get rid of dropping on top sleet.
The anti-condensation ice cable of this structure is best suited for the situation that a snowstorm is raging, in addition, rotates smoothly on cable in order to guarantee anti-condensation set, and the length of anti-condensation set is difficult for being provided with long, the mode that can adopt segmentation to be provided with.The whirlpool leaf can be provided with continuously on the anti-condensation set surface, also can be provided with in the anti-condensation set surface segment.
More than be described with regard to several typical fit system of anti-condensation set and cable, except that above-mentioned fit system, can also utilize strip material to make spiral helicine anti-condensation set, be linked in the cable solderless wrapped connection then and constitute anti-condensation ice cable of the present invention, also can realize same effect.
Embodiment eight
As the open-air transmission of electricity insulating bottle of Fig. 8, the present invention shown in Figure 9, anti-condensation set 16 is set at the upper surface of insulating bottle full skirt 18.Anti-condensation set is made of the low macromolecular material of coefficient of thermal conductivity, is shaped as taper shape, for shorten the time that rainwater stops on anti-condensation set, also is provided with on the anti-condensation set surface and refuses moisture film 17.The external diameter of anti-condensation set should be slightly larger than the external diameter of insulating bottle full skirt.The center of anti-condensation set is provided with through hole 19.
Anti-condensation set 16 covers can be covered on the full skirt 18 during assembling, then both are arranged on the open-air transmission of electricity insulating bottle of formation the present invention on the plug 15 by central through hole.
Owing to be provided with and have the anti-condensation set 16 of refusing moisture film, greatly reduce the capacity of heat transmission on insulating bottle full skirt surface, prevented that rainwater from falling to going up the back and being coagulated ice because of heat conducts the moment that causes of coming rapidly, improved the water repellency of insulating bottle simultaneously, can rapid slippage after making rainwater etc. fall to going up, avoid accumulating, thereby the insulating bottle that effectively prevents take place to coagulate ice, be particularly suitable for open-air transmission of electricity and use.Anti-condensation set can or bond with insulating bottle full skirt overlap joint, also can predetermined fixed be bound up before dispatching from the factory.
Embodiment nine
As Figure 10, the open-air transmission of electricity insulating bottle of the present invention shown in Figure 11, be with the difference of embodiment one, for the insulating bottle of full skirt 18 with plug 15 integrated setting, because anti-condensation set is inconvenient and the full skirt socket, therefore anti-condensation set adopt elasticity preferably heat-barrier material make, and on anti-condensation set 16, radial opening is set, so just can realize smoothly anti-condensation condom is ridden on the full skirt of insulating bottle.For the ease of the rainwater landing, socket join structure is set in anti-condensation set and full skirt edge.For shorten the time that rainwater stops on anti-condensation set, anti-condensation set is made of altogether coefficient of thermal conductivity low macromolecular material and water-proof material.
Based on the technology of present embodiment, can carry out anti-condensation ice transformation to existing insulating bottle easily.
Except that taper shape, can also to be arranged to annular, mushroom-shaped or anti-condensation set soffit similar with the corresponding surface configuration of bottle for anti-condensation set as required.In addition, anti-condensation set also can be made by the low non-metal inorganic material of coefficient of thermal conductivity.
Embodiment ten
The open-air metal tower body of the anti-condensation ice of the present invention as shown in Figure 12 and Figure 13, at the anti-condensation element 21 of steel column 20 surperficial sockets that constitutes tower body, anti-condensation element 21 mainly is made of the low expanded material of coefficient of thermal conductivity, also is provided with one deck at anti-condensation element surface and refuses moisture film 22.
By anti-condensation element being set on the steel column surface that constitutes tower body, and utilize to set up and refuse moisture film at anti-condensation element surface, reduce tower body and easily coagulated the surperficial capacity of heat transmission of ice, prevent that rainwater from falling to going up the back and being coagulated ice because of heat conducts the moment that causes of coming rapidly, improved the water repellency of tower body simultaneously, can rapid slippage after making sleet etc. fall to going up, avoid accumulating, thereby the phenomenon of icing with fixed attention that can effectively prevent takes place.Be specially adapted to open-air high voltage power transmission tower and the signal tower of using.
Embodiment 11
Open-air metal tower body as Figure 12, the anti-condensation ice of the present invention shown in Figure 14, be that with the difference of embodiment ten anti-condensation element 21 easily coagulates sheet material 24 and the sheet material 26 of icing the surface for sticking on the angle steel 23 that constitutes tower body, establish cutwater on the sheet material 24 and split 25, this sheet material is made by the low foamed polyurethane of coefficient of thermal conductivity, has dosed water-proof material in the skin-material, and cavity is established at the middle part, not only save material, weight reduction has more elasticity, and tool thermal insulation and water repellency.
The anti-condensation element of the open-air metal tower body of the anti-condensation ice of the present invention is split at the vertical cutwater that has, and is convenient to the sleet landing and does not retain; Can also be designed to the shape that other has low air resistance coefficient in the horizontal direction,, be convenient to reduce the lateral force of tower body as water droplet shape, ellipse, fusiformis, two sharp water droplet shape or circle.
The anti-condensation element of easily icing the setting of surface, position with fixed attention of the open-air metal tower body of the anti-condensation ice of the present invention can also be sheet or other shapes, and is arranged on bar, the post surface of forming tower body with snapping, socket, co-extrusion, coating or bonding way.Anti-condensation element can select for use low non-metal inorganic material of coefficient of thermal conductivity or macromolecular material to constitute, and can effectively play anti-condensation ice action.
